This D-44 is referred to as a D44M with the M denoting "Modernized".
It was Polish-made in 1959 and modernized in the 1970s with the addition of an electrical system and lights.
It is in original condition as part of a group obtained directly from the Polish government in 2014.
We believe the remaining cannons subsequently went to Ukraine.
This cannon includes cut breach parts and a telescopic direct-fire scope.
